44114 ZIP Code – Cleveland, Ohio
44114 is a mid-sized ZIP code in Cleveland, Ohio, part of Cuyahoga County with a population of approximately 6,953 residents. At $49,269, the median household income here runs below the Ohio average and below the U.S. average. At $100,300, median home values run well below the national average, with 7.0% owner-occupied housing (decreasing). ; median rent of $1,271 is similarly above the national average. Housing consists of 12% single-family (increasing), 84% apartments (increasing).
The area reports an unemployment rate of 7.2%, above the national average. The poverty rate is 44.5%, well above the national average. Bachelor's degree attainment is 47.2%, well above the national average. Residents have a median age of 29.0, below the U.S. median. Neighboring ZIP codes include 44115, 44103, 44101.

ZIP 44114 vs. Ohio vs. U.S.
| Metric | ZIP 44114 | OH Avg. | U.S. Avg. |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 6,953 | 9,667 | 10k |
| Median Household Income | $49k | $68k | $73k |
| Median Home Value | $100k | $170k | $258k |
| Median Rent | $1,271 | $889 | $1,088 |
| Median Age | 29.0 | 41.7 | 43.2 |
| Unemployment Rate | 7.2% | 4.9% | 5.0% |
| Poverty Rate | 44.5% | 13.2% | 13.3% |
| Bachelor's Degree or Higher | 47.2% | 22.5% | 26.9% |
